operational biosecurity refers to the set of measures and protocols put in place to prevent the introduction, emergence, spread, and release of harmful biological agents that can pose a threat to human, animal, or plant health. These agents can include pathogens, toxins, and other harmful substances that can cause disease, disrupt ecosystems, and even threaten national security. Therefore, it is essential for governments, organizations, and individuals to implement operational biosecurity measures to safeguard public health and safety.

One of the key aspects of operational biosecurity is biosecurity risk management, which involves identifying potential threats, assessing their likelihood and impact, and developing strategies to prevent, detect, and respond to them. This can involve implementing physical barriers such as fences, gates, and locks to control access to sensitive areas, conducting regular inspections and audits to monitor for potential breaches, and implementing training and awareness programs to educate staff on biosecurity protocols and procedures.

Another important component of operational biosecurity is biosecurity surveillance, which involves monitoring and tracking potential threats to identify and assess their risks. This can involve collecting and analyzing data on disease outbreaks, pest infestations, and other biological incidents to identify patterns and trends that could indicate a potential threat. By establishing robust surveillance systems, organizations can quickly detect and respond to biological threats before they become widespread, helping to protect public health and safety.

operational biosecurity also involves biocontainment, which refers to the measures taken to prevent the release of harmful biological agents from controlled environments. This can include implementing physical containment systems such as air filtration and waste management systems to prevent the escape of pathogens, implementing personal protective equipment such as gloves, masks, and gowns to protect workers from exposure, and implementing decontamination procedures to clean and disinfect contaminated areas.

In addition to these measures, operational biosecurity also encompasses biosecurity emergency response, which involves developing and implementing strategies to respond to biological incidents and emergencies. This can include establishing emergency response plans, training staff on emergency procedures, and conducting regular drills and exercises to test the effectiveness of response plans. By being prepared to respond to biological emergencies, organizations can minimize the impact of outbreaks and mitigate their effects on public health and safety.
